This itinerary adds more time for key attractions and a more relaxed pace.
Focus: Paro, Thimphu, and a scenic drive to Punakha.
Best for: Those who want to see more than just the basics without rushing.
Arrival in Paro & Thimphu Exploration
Morning: Arrive at Paro International Airport (PBH) and meet your guide.
Late Morning: Drive to Thimphu.
Afternoon:
Buddha Dordenma: Visit the magnificent Buddha statue for stunning views.
Tashichho Dzong: Take a guided tour of the fortress.
National Memorial Chorten: Spend time at this spiritual landmark.
National Textile Museum & Folk Heritage Museum: Get a glimpse into Bhutanese culture and traditional arts.
Evening: Enjoy a leisurely evening in Thimphu, perhaps visiting the Centenary Farmers' Market (if it's a weekend) or exploring local shops.

A Taste of Punakha
Morning: Drive to Dochula Pass (approx. 1 hour). On a clear day, you can see a panoramic view of the eastern Himalayan range. The pass is also home to 108 memorial stupas.
Afternoon: Descend into the sub-tropical Punakha valley. Visit the stunning Punakha Dzong, considered the most beautiful fortress in Bhutan, situated at the confluence of two rivers.
Evening: Drive back to Thimphu or Paro for the night (depending on your preference and tour operator's plan).

Thimphu Cultural Immersion & Drive to Paro
Morning: Explore more of Thimphu's cultural sites. Options include:
National Folk Heritage Museum: Provides a glimpse into traditional Bhutanese rural life.
National Institute for Zorig Chusum (Painting School): Observe students learning Bhutan's 13 traditional arts.
Takin Preserve: See Bhutan's unique national animal, the Takin.
Afternoon: Drive to Paro. Visit Rinpung Dzong and the National Museum upon arrival.
Evening: Enjoy a traditional hot stone bath (optional) or explore Paro town.

Tiger's Nest Hike & Departure
Morning: The entire morning is dedicated to the hike to Paro Taktsang (Tiger's Nest). Take your time to enjoy the trail, the views, and the sacred atmosphere.
Afternoon: After the hike, have lunch and return to the valley floor.
Late Afternoon: If time permits before your flight, visit Kyichu Lhakhang, one of the oldest and most important temples in the country.
Evening: Transfer to Paro International Airport for your departure, carrying with you memories of the "Land of the Thunder Dragon."
